Vamos analisar as opções: a. create table reservas(Numerovoo char(3), RG int, valor float, primary Key(Numerovoo, RG)); - Esta opção está correta ao definir as colunas e a chave primária. b. create table reservas(int: Numerovoo, RG;valor:float; primary Key (NumeroVoo,RG), foreign key (NumeroVoo,RG)); - Esta opção possui erros de sintaxe e na definição das chaves estrangeiras. c. create table reservas(Numerovoo char(3), RG int, valor float, primary Key(Numerovoo, RG), foreign Key(Numerovoo) references Voos (NumeroVoo), foreign Key(RG) references Passageiros (RG)); - Esta opção está correta ao definir as colunas, a chave primária e as chaves estrangeiras. d. create table reservas(int: Numerovoo, RG;valor:float; primary Key (NumeroVoo,RG)); - Esta opção possui erros de sintaxe na definição das colunas. e. create table reservas(int: Numerovoo, RG;valor:float; primary Key (NumeroVoo)); - Esta opção possui erros de sintaxe na definição das colunas. Portanto, a opção correta é: c. create table reservas(Numerovoo char(3), RG int, valor float, primary Key(Numerovoo, RG), foreign Key(Numerovoo) references Voos (NumeroVoo), foreign Key(RG) references Passageiros (RG)).
Para escrever sua resposta aqui, entre ou crie uma conta
Compartilhar